How These Sources Deliver Reliable, Practical Value
Each platform serves a unique but complementary role. The World Atlas simplifies complex geography with clear maps and concise facts. The CIA World Factbook provides authoritative demographic and economic data—ideal for researchers and policy analysts. The Burundi Ministry of Tourism breaks down travel access, attractions, and cultural experiences, guiding adventurers and travel businesses. The UN Environment Programme shares forward-looking data on biodiversity, carbon emissions, and regional sustainability efforts.
Together, they form a trusted ecosystem: users cross-reference tourism potential, social indicators, and environmental health—giving them a holistic, fact-based foundation for decisions about travel, investment, or global citizenship.

Key Considerations Before Relying on Global Data
Accuracy does not mean universal alignment. Cultural context, reporting timelines, and local priorities influence each source’s presentation. For example, demographic statistics may reflect recent census trends, while environmental reports often reflect policy targets rather than current conditions. Users benefit from cross-referencing where possible and recognizing each platform’s unique focus.
Misinterpretation can arise from uncritical reliance—so critical thinking remains essential. These resources inform, but informed judgment requires clear context.
